Lecturer Capacity Building in Developing Video-Based Learning Media Eko Risdianto; Yessi Marlina; Sri Mulyani; Fitri Fitri; Roziana Roziana; Lily Restusari

Abstract

The community service aims to increase the capacity of lecturers in developing video-based learning media. The service method is carried out through training activities. The target of the service is the Nutrition Department Lecturers of the Riau Ministry of Health Polytechnic. As many as 14 Nutrition Lecturers were involved in the training which was held in July 2023. The research instrument used was a closed sheet with four answer choices. Analysis of the training participants' responses to the training activities for making learning videos was carried out using descriptive statistical analysis. This is done by processing the proportion of data from filling in the responses by the training participants. Percentages are obtained based on modified Likert Scale calculations. The results showed that as many as 14 respondents or 100% of the respondents were in the category of strongly agreeing with the statements that led to a positive response from the trainees to the training activities that had been carried out. Follow-up workshops on creating innovative learning videos are urgently needed to acquire new skills for Teachers/Lecturers of the Department of Nutrition at the Riau Ministry of Health Polytechnic.
Increasing the Role of Posyandu Cadres in Prevention of Heart Disease in Harjosari Village, Pekanbaru City Yessi Alza; Ani Laila; Roziana Roziana

Abstract

This activity aims to improve the knowledge and role of Posyandu cadres in Harjosari Village, Pekanbaru City, to prevent heart disease. This activity is carried out as Posyandu cadre training on anthropometric measurements, blood cholesterol examinations, and counseling on healthy eating patterns to prevent heart disease. The activity was conducted at the BRIMOB Posyandu, Harjosari Village, attended by 16 Posyandu cadres. The activity began with anthropometric measurements to determine nutritional status, body fat composition, blood cholesterol examinations, and counseling on healthy eating patterns with the Mediterranean Diet. Mapping the results of anthropometric measurements and blood tests, especially cholesterol levels, shows that most Posyandu cadres are at risk of heart disease. After counseling, the cadres significantly increased their knowledge about heart disease and the Mediterranean diet. Community service activities in Harjosari Village have improved the Posyandu cadres' ability to prevent heart disease. This increase shows the effectiveness of training in strengthening the role of Posyandu cadres in educating the community about a healthy lifestyle and preventing heart disease. There has been an increase in cadres' knowledge about heart disease and the Mediterranean diet so that they are better prepared to educate the community about the importance of a healthy diet to prevent heart disease.
